How they compare
Kazakhstan currently reports 297,664 current LCU per person against 166,465 current LCU per person in Tanzania, United Republic of, a difference of 131,199 current LCU per person.
That makes Kazakhstan's figure about 1.8 times Tanzania, United Republic of's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Tanzania, United Republic of ahead.
Kazakhstan ranks 17th and Tanzania, United Republic of ranks 20th of 157 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Kazakhstan averaged higher in 1 and Tanzania, United Republic of in 1.

About this data
Taxes on goods and services (current L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
